Why Does This Property Have a G Rating?

This terraced flat is located in LUTON, LU1 1NU. The property offers 45m² (484 sq ft) of compact living space with 2 habitable rooms. It is a period property with Victorian or earlier origins. Currently rated G (12/100) for energy efficiency, this property would benefit significantly from energy improvements. With recommended improvements, it could achieve a D rating (58/100). The solid walls lack insulation. Solid wall insulation (external or internal) typically costs £8,000-£14,000 but can reduce heat loss by up to 35% and improve your EPC rating by 1-2 bands. The pitched roof lacks adequate insulation. Topping up loft insulation to 270mm (the recommended depth) typically costs £300-£500 and could save £150-£250 annually, with the investment often paying for itself within 2-3 years. Double glazing is installed, though the efficiency rating suggests older units. Modern low-E double glazing can be up to 40% more efficient than units installed before 2002. Estimated annual energy costs are £3334, comprising £2989 for heating, £285 for hot water, and £60 for lighting. The property produces 6.0 tonnes of CO2 per year, which is above average for a UK home. IMPORTANT FOR LANDLORDS: With an EPC rating of G, this property does not meet the Minimum Energy Efficiency Standards (MEES). Since April 2020, landlords cannot legally let properties rated F or G without registering a valid exemption. Penalties for non-compliance can reach up to £30,000. Immediate improvements are required to bring the property to at least an E rating.
